Pomoc - Szukaj - Użytkownicy - Kalendarz
Pełna wersja: [HTML][CSS] Wyłączenie kodu HTML + liczenie linijek
Forum PHP.pl > Forum > Przedszkole
Turson
W jaki sposób mogę osiągnąć efekt działania kodów forum bbcode jak [ PHP ] [ HTML ] [ CSS ] bez odstępów.
Chodzi mi o liczenie linijek+aby w tym obszarze przeglądarka nie interpretowała kodu.
sadistic_son
Nie czaję o co Ci chodzi. Wyrzucasz kod php poza znaczniki <?php ?> i kod zostanie wyświetlony na stronie jako kod html. I po problemie.
Turson
To git, a jeśli chodzi o liczenie linijek?
sadistic_son
no to podziel sobie string w miejscach enterów, pododawaj cyfry i połącz spowrotem:
  1. $string='to jest kod php<br>zpisany<br>w<br>kilku<br>linijkach';
  2. $echo=explode('<br>',$string);
  3. $i=0;
  4. $new='';
  5. foreach($echo as $e){
  6. $i++;
  7. $new=$new.'<br>linijka: '.$i.') '.$e;
  8.  
  9. }
  10. echo $new;
Lub jeśli kod pochodzi z textarea lub inputa to:
  1. $string='to jest kod php
  2. zpisany
  3. w
  4. kilku
  5. linijkach';
  6. $echo=explode("\n",$string);
  7. //itd jak powyzej
Nie jestem pewien jak to jest z plikami txt ale chyba musisz dzielić po \r\n
To jest wersja lo-fi głównej zawartości. Aby zobaczyć pełną wersję z większą zawartością, obrazkami i formatowaniem proszę kliknij tutaj.
Invision Power Board © 2001-2025 Invision Power Services, Inc.